Death Valley, California vs Suphan Buri Climate & Distance Between

Thailand flag
  • The distance between Death Valley, California, Usa and Suphan Buri, Thailand is approximately 13,150 km or 8,172 mi.
  • To reach Death Valley, California in this distance one would set out from Suphan Buri bearing 33.3°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Death Valley, California bearing 138.6° or SE .
  • Death Valley, California has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Suphan Buri has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Death Valley, California is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Suphan Buri is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 3.7 °C (6.7°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.5 °C (38.7°F) more in Death Valley, California.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1065.5 mm (41.9 in) less which is equivalent to 1065.5 l/m² (26.15 US gal/ft²) or 10,655,000 l/ha (1,139,090 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.5° lower in Death Valley, California than in Suphan Buri.
